The Remarkable Story Of How A People And Country Embraced Each OtherAnd Ultimately Left Their Identities Inextricably Linked.For Many Centuries, Chinese Migrated To The Ports, Cities And Provinces Of Thailand. These Immigrants Included Traders, Skilled Laborers, Adventurers And The Neardestitute Who Dreamed Of A Better Life. Over Time, They Came To Form One Of The Largest And Most Influential Diasporas In The World. From Tin Mining To RailwayBuilding To Rice Trading, Their Skills Helped The Country Develop And Prosper. Some Came To Advise Thai Monarchs, Intermarry, And Run Businesses Integral To The Economy. One Son Of A Chinese Father And Thai Mother Even Became King. This Community Overcame Many Personal, Cultural And Social Challenges To Eventually Become An Integral Part Of Almost All The KingdomS Affairs All The Way Through To The Present Day. This Book Tells The Extraordinary History Of The ThaiChinese.No Country In Southeast Asia Has Been As Successful As Thailand In Integrating Its Chinese Community.
